Whispering Sun by Rita Karnopp

New Territory of Montana 1863. Sarah Bryson’s silent world is destroyed when her so-called fiancĂ© has her kidnapped to prevent his discovery as a gun-runner.  After surviving a massacre, she is rescued by Blackfeet warrior, Two Shadows.  But in order to reach the safety of his village, they must confront wild animals, ruthless mountain men, treacherous mountain storms, and Crow Indians bent on revenge.
 

Sarah seeks her true identity as a woman.  Two Shadows’ struggles with loyalties divided between his love for a white woman and his devotion to his tribe.  Whispering Sun captures a time when the Blackfeet are forced to see their way of life disappear.  It’s a story where it’s possible for a white woman to decide she belongs with a loving people and a Blackfeet warrior.  It’s a story that shows how a half-breed can choose an alliance and find his place in a colliding world.   

"Rita Karnopp has composed both a creative and enduring tale of trials and tribulations that are, oh, too real, and leave an overwhelming impact on the reader. From betrayal, to finding love, she has written a masterpiece that is hard to put down." ~ Cherokee, Coffee Time Romance

NOWHERE TO HIDE

  

Eppie Winner ~ Best Thriller

   
 
SHE DARED TO CHALLENGE A MERCILESS KILLER




Raised in an atmosphere of violence and unpredictability, Ellen and Gail Morgan have banded together, survivors of a booze-fertilized battleground, forming a fierce united front against an often cold and uncaring world. When their parents are killed in a car crash, Ellen becomes the mother figure for Gail.


When fifteen years later Gail is brutally raped and murdered in her shabby New York basement apartment, practically on the eve of her big breakthrough as a singer, Ellen is inconsolable. Rage at her younger sister's murder has nearly consumed her. So when her work as a psychologist wins her an appearance on the evening news, Ellen seizes the moment. Staring straight into the camera, she challenges the killer to come out of hiding: "Why don't you come after me? I'll be waiting for you."


Phone calls flood the station, but all leads go nowhere. The police investigation seems doomed to failure. Then it happens: a note, written in red ink, slipped under the windshield wipers of her car, 'YOU'RE IT.' Ellen has stirred the monster in his lair … and the hunter has become the hunted!
